**Mgmt Meeting Minutes — Retiring the Brightline Range**

Quick recap for sales leads at Fenholt Supplies: we agreed to retire the Brightline fixture range by year-end. Remaining stock moves to clearance pricing next month, and accounts on standing orders get migrated to the Lumetta range. Trade-in incentives were approved in principle. The confidential note on next steps sits just below.

board note of bajof-bajeg: The pricing group signed off on a budget of $13.4 million for Project Sildor. The renewal with Lamixek Holdings closes at $48.9 million a year, 49 percent above the last contract.

- [ ] **Step 7: Breaker override escrow.** After sealing the signing keys for the Tallgrove upstream API circuit breaker, confirm the support team can force the breaker open during a full outage. The override bundle lives in the sealed escrow drawer and is useless without its unlock phrase. Two ceremony witnesses must initial this step before proceeding. The escrow bundle is decrypted with the recovery passphrase that follows.

vault phrase of kahip-kahop = holath-quenmir

☐ Step 4 — CSV import wizard (Quillbarrow Console). Confirm the wizard rejects files over 10 MB, maps headers case-insensitively, and logs row-level errors to the import audit trail. Support signs off only after a dry run with the sample roster file completes cleanly. Then the custodian opens the sealed card and dictates the recovery passphrase, recorded on the line below.

recovery phrase for bawep-kawef: oliath-casdor